Organizer(s): Richard (the Magnificent) Larsen
Date: 2003-05-18
Kayakers (K1): David Hill,Bill Kallack
Canoers (OC1): Richard Larsen,Sheri Larsen,Len Carpenter
Predominantly: Intermediate WW
Water Level: Medium
Primary Realtime USGS Gauge Site: North Creek
Primary Realtime USGS Gauge Height (ft), e.g. '2.96': 4.9
This was a trip organized in short order because of expected great weather and water level - and all turned out to be true. It was a beautiful cloudless day, with a high in the mid-70s, and with the North Creek Gauge at 4.9 feet. All in all, it was a perfect Class 3 trip. We put in at North Creek at about 10:30AM, and paddled to the Glen Bridge, taking out around 3:30PM. We saw a fox walking along the shore, and Common Mergansers and Canada Geese on the river. The rapids were pushy, but none were overwhelming. We had lunch at the Riparius Bridge, which was under construction, so the area was somewhat disrupted. The Creemee stand at the train station was, however, open, so some were able to enhance the river food with another of the major food groups. What more could one want from a whitewater trip? We had good rapids, warm temperature, clear sky, and Creemees.
